/*
 * Fixture: compressed telemetry payload for the Skylark ingest tests.
 * Payloads are zstd-compressed before upload; the decompressor enforces a
 * 4 MB inflation cap to prevent bomb-style inputs. This fixture contains
 * a borderline 3.9 MB sample so the cap logic is exercised. When running
 * these tests against the shared ingest sandbox, the client must
 * authenticate using the bearer token below.
 */

login token, bagug-kafop: eyJhbGciOiJIUzI1NiIsInR5cCI6IkpXVCJ9.eyJzdWIiOiIcMLov2In0.Z5RLDIfp

Hi,

As part of Thursday's disaster-recovery drill, we'll rebuild the Corvette release entirely inside the new hermetic build system, Cinderbox. No network fetches are permitted; all toolchains and dependencies are pinned in the sealed artifact store. Your role is to verify the output digests match the attested manifest and flag any nondeterminism. If the primary signer is unavailable during the drill, the standby vault must be unsealed manually. The passphrase for unsealing is recorded below.

unlock words, hahip-baduf: holwyn-istath-julvan

**Q: Why is my Pondrel handler slow on the first call?**

Cold starts. The runtime provisions a fresh sandbox when a handler hasn't run recently, adding 1–3 seconds. Mitigations: enable warm pools in the Pondrel console, trim dependency size, avoid heavy init code. Warm pools cost extra and need team-lead approval. If latency persists after warm pools are on, contact the platform team at the address below.

alerts address for kajog-tadup: druox@plorvanet.internal

Handover: Thumbwick queue

Plugin authors hit the Thumbwick thumbnail queue via the enqueue API only — never the Redis backend directly. Jobs over 40MB get rejected. Retries are three, then dead-lettered to the Ashgrove bucket. Priority lanes exist but are reserved for the Pictora core pipeline; plugins get the default lane. Rate limits are per plugin key. Your plugin manifest must declare these values exactly as the staging environment expects, listed below.

service settings:
[casax]
port = 6379
team = rusir
host = casax.zemvarhq.corp
region = outer-4
access_code = ac_9808ce
timeout_ms = 1500